Tight security to be taken for Eid-ul-Fitr: Home boss

Secretariat Correspondent: Home Minister Asaduzzaman Khan Kamal said security measures will be beefed up across the country to ensure the peaceful celebrations of Eid-ul-Fitr, the biggest religious festival of Muslims.

“Adequate security personnel will be deployed alongside conducting block raids in different towns. Besides, there’ll be check-posts at the entry and exit points of the capital,” he said while talking to reporters after a meeting with members of law enforcement agencies at the Secretariat on Sunday.

In reply to a question whether there is any threat of sabotage, Asaduzzaman said: “No, there’s no threat of sabotage. Intelligence agencies have been on alert.”

He asked the owners of garment factories to allow the workers to leave in phases and pay their salaries and bonus in time.

The minister said action will be taken if buses or launches carry passengers beyond their capacities and passengers are charged extra fare.
